Shortbread, mascarpone, and passion fruit
7 reviews 4.3 : Very good
Diet
Vegetarian
Level
Intermediate
Preparation
30 minutes
Cooking
15 minutes
Wait
1 hour

Here’s one of my recipes that always impresses guests: mascarpone and passion fruit shortbread cookies. These little cookies are a delicious, gourmet-style dessert—yet quite easy to make. You’ll just need to make sure you have the necessary utensils, which I’ve listed along with the ingredients.

Plus, this recipe can be adapted in many ways. Here, I’ve chosen to top the shortbread with passion fruit pulp, but you can also use other fresh fruits depending on the season: blueberries, figs, mandarins… Depending on the fruit (juicy or not), serve the fresh fruit pieces with a coulis or jam diluted with a little water.

These mascarpone shortbread cookies can be prepared in advance—both the cookies and the topping—in which case you should store them in the fridge in an airtight container for no more than one day (since mascarpone is a fresh, uncooked cheese).

When it’s time to serve, all you’ll need to do is slice the fruit and top the shortbread cookies.

Ingredients for Shortbread, mascarpone, and passion fruit

  • For the shortbread cookies
  • Image de white flour
    8.8 oz of white flour
  • Image de butter
    4.2 oz of butter limp
  • Image de sugar
    3.5 oz of sugar white sugar, or brown sugar for a caramelized flavor, or muscovado sugar for a more pronounced flavor
  • Image de egg
    2 eggs 1 whole egg + 1 egg yolk
  • Image de baking powder
    1 bag of baking powder
  • Image de salt
    1 pinch of salt
  • For the filling
  • Image de passion fruit
    6 passion fruit
  • Image de mascarpone
    5.3 oz of mascarpone
  • Image de heavy cream
    1.8 oz of heavy cream
  • Image de powdered sugar
    1.8 oz of powdered sugar
  • Kitchen utensils
  • Image de pastry ring
    6 pastry rings 8 to 10 cm in diameter, or shortbread molds
  • Image de baking mat
    1 baking mat (optional: you can use parchment paper instead)

Shortbread, mascarpone, and passion fruit : instructions

  • Making the shortbread dough
    • 1
      Take the mascarpone out of the fridge and let it soften at room temperature.
    • 2
      In a mixing bowl, combine the flour, butter, sugar, and salt.
      Rub the mixture between your hands for about 3 minutes, until it resembles coarse crumbs, much like couscous.

    • 3
      Add the whole egg and the extra egg yolk. Mix by hand to combine all the ingredients, and as soon as you see the dough starting to form, stop mixing; otherwise, it will become too elastic.

    • 4
      Shape the dough into two balls (if it’s too sticky, sprinkle a small handful of flour on it first).
      Flatten the dough balls slightly, dust them with a little flour, then place them in an airtight container.

    • 5
      Place the airtight container in the refrigerator and let it rest for at least 40 minutes so the butter can firm up.
      The airtight container will help the dough retain its moisture, especially if you let it rest overnight!

  • Making the mascarpone cream
    • 6
      Place the mascarpone in a mixing bowl, then add the crème fraîche and the powdered sugar.
      Mix vigorously until the ingredients are well combined and the mixture is smooth.

  • Baking shortbread cookies
    • 7
      Take the shortcrust pastry out of the fridge and roll it out on a silicone baking mat or, if you don’t have one, a sheet of parchment paper.
      The rolled-out dough should be about half a centimeter thick.
      The Chef's Tip
      The dough shouldn’t be too thick because it will rise further during baking due to the baking powder.

    • 8
      Next, cut the dough into rounds using pastry rings with a diameter of 8 to 10 cm.
      The Chef's Tip
      Be sure to keep the pastry rings around the dough rounds, even while baking (unlike in the photo, where I had removed them!). This way, they won’t lose their shape during baking, ensuring a perfect final result.

    • 9
      Place the baking mat or parchment paper with the dough rounds on a baking rack.
      Bake the shortbread cookies for 15 minutes.

    • 10
      Remove from the oven as soon as it's done baking and let it cool.
  • Final assembly
    • 11
      Spread a layer of mascarpone cream on each shortbread cookie, using the pastry ring to keep it from spilling over. Remove the pastry ring.

    • 12
      For each shortbread cookie, cut the passion fruit in half and spread the pulp and seeds over the cookie.
      The Chef's Tip
      Don't do this on the serving plate, as you'll end up getting it dirty with crumbs, filling, or passion fruit seeds.

    • 13
      Decorate your serving plates. Place a shortbread cookie on each one and serve them to your amazed guests 😋😍.

Notes

WHAT TO DRINK WITH THESE MASCARPONE SAND CAKES? Champagne or a white sparkling wine... or why not a Lambrusco to stay true to the Italian spirit of mascarpone!
